California police find 2 bodies in a truck up in the Santa Cruz Mountains

Police officers and detectives in California are working to figure out why two bodies were found in a pickup truck, abandoned in the Santa Cruz Mountains. 

The truck was discovered along Highway 35 and Skyline Boulevard about three miles south of Castle Rock State Park. The bodies were in the back of a large Ford Heavy-Duty truck. 

California Highway Patrol shared that this is an active and ongoing investigation. Two deceased individuals were located in the vehicle, but their deaths were not witnessed. They are coded as suspicious until a coroner can confirm the cause and manner of death. 

According to NBC Bay Area, if the autopsy report indicates foul play then they’ll follow up on a few investigative leads. But it’s currently a mystery. The truck was in an area with very few residents and no visible surveillance cameras. 

A tow truck was escorted by the police to haul the truck away. Castle Rock is a popular area among hikers, though. Some people were shocked by the grim discovery because of how popular the park is. 

Unfortunately, questions will remain unanswered until the coroner is able to provide some clues. Investigators aren’t even sure about the identities of the deceased yet. Stay tuned for updates.
